when I compaired the Blue and the black even in bright light you could definitely see the diff however the Blue is a dark blue unlike the Nav world blue that has a glow to it especially in the sun. The White on the other hand Jumps out at you. That is a good point though, anyone who knows Breitling would never confuse the 2 but they are somewhat a similar look
